Cooking Steps

  1. Step1:Prepare ingredients: Six egg tarts, 20g white sugar, 90g milk (or formula), 10g low gluten flour, 90g light cream and two yolk

  2. Step2:Heat the milk a little. Just touch the warm one. If the formula is used, it can be brewed directly with warm water, which saves the steps of heating the mil

  3. Step3:Pour sugar, egg yolk and cream into milk respectively. Stir wel

  6. Step6:Low gluten flour sifted and stirred until it is free of particle

  7. Step7:Sift the batter well stirred. Filter out bubbles and particle

  9. Step9:At this time, preheat the oven at 190 degrees, and pour the mixed paste into the egg tart skin. It's enough to make it eight points full

  11. Step11:Heat up and down for 190 degrees. Bake for 25 minutes. The specific time needs to be controlled according to different tempers of your ove
